Washington state Gov. Bob Ferguson on Tuesday announced that banning cellphone use in kindergarten through 12th grade throughout the school day will be one of his top priorities when lawmakers convene in January.
“More than half of states across the country are moving in one direction, and one direction only. They’re passing laws to keep cell phones out of classrooms,” Ferguson said. “Washington state is not one of them, and that must change in the next legislative session.”
Despite mounting concern, Washington has moved cautiously on the issue. Legislators passed a law in March requiring the Office of the Superintendent of Public Instruction to study district phone policies, review research and gather student input for an analysis due at the end of 2027.
Ferguson is urging faster action, seeking all-day bans on the devices in public schools by the start of the 2027-28 academic year. Superintendent of Public Instruction Chris Reykdal also supports a ban and is proposing a similar policy.
A study published in January from the University of Washington School of Medicine and others found that U.S. adolescents ages 13-18 spend more than one hour per day on phones during school hours, with “addictive” social media apps accounting for the largest share of use. Newly released documents reveal strategies employed by social media companies that aim to increase student use of the apps.
At the same time, the impact of phone restrictions are less clear. Recent research found that test scores did not improve at schools where cellphones were put away all day, but teachers observed fewer distractions and students reported a greater sense of personal well-being, per the New York Times.
Support among teachers is strong. At the Washington Education Association’s annual meeting in April, nearly 1,000 educators passed a resolution almost unanimously to ban cellphones during school.
“We support a statewide ‘away for the day’ cellphone policy, so that students can focus on learning, growing, and reaching their full potential,” said Larry Delaney, president of the WEA. “We owe it to our students to make this happen.”
The push comes as local districts are already acting. Last month, Seattle Public Schools instituted a district-wide policy requiring K-8 students to put phones away for the entire school day. High schoolers must store them during instruction time but have access during lunch and passing periods. Exemptions exist for health and educational needs.
Tuesday’s announcement was made at Robert Eagle Staff Middle School, one of the first in the district to institute an all-day phone ban. The speakers included Zoe Taggart, a seventh grader at the school.
Taggart said that while she sometimes misses her phone, the benefits to students are clear. “We spend more time talking to each other, building friendships and relationships in the present day,” she said. “Instead of texting someone who’s right down the hall, we actually go down and find them and have a real conversation.”
The Phone-Free Schools State Report Card, which rates school cellphone policies nationwide, gives Washington and three other states a failing grade for lacking statewide regulations.
Four states have earned “A” grades for requiring phones to be fully inaccessible during the entire school day, or “bell-to-bell.” Twenty states plus Washington, D.C., have “B” grades for all-day restrictions, though in those cases devices are stored in lockers or backpacks, keeping them potentially within reach.
Samsung’s new rugged smartwatch hasn’t changed much on the outside, but the biggest upgrades on the Galaxy Watch Ultra 2 are all hiding inside.
It has a larger battery, more powerful processor and new adventure features to take you from the office to the trails without extra gear. At $700 ($50 more than the original Galaxy Watch Ultra), it’s the most expensive watch in Samsung’s lineup, but it’s also the most durable and arguably the most interesting.
I’ve spent the past week testing the Galaxy Watch Ultra 2, and while the verdict is still out on its long-term features, like health tracking and battery life, it’s clear that it can pull double duty as both an adventure-ready companion and a luxury smartwatch.
Whether its $700 price tag is justified depends on what you’re looking for. If you want Samsung’s most rugged watch with the biggest battery, brightest display and the most outdoor features, it could be worth the premium. But if the package matters less than the core smartwatch features, you may be better off getting the standard Galaxy Watch 9 (or even older models) for nearly half the price.

The Galaxy Watch Ultra 2 looks identical to the original. It has the same premium titanium case, sapphire crystal display, signature squircle design and three programmable physical buttons. But look closer and you’ll notice a few subtle upgrades.
The display is slightly larger (1.52” compared to 1.5” on the original), even though the overall watch is smaller and lighter. Samsung also redesigned the bands, making them thinner and more breathable so the watch sits flatter against your wrist, which the company says improves sensor contact. The new clasp mechanism makes them easier to swap than traditional watch bands, though it also locks you into Samsung’s proprietary system.

The fact that I slept a few nights without ripping it off halfway through the night says a lot for a watch this size. I still wouldn’t choose to sleep with it long-term, but it’s noticeably more comfortable than I expected.
Samsung watches already have the best displays in the business, and the Ultra 2 kicks it up a notch with an even brighter, 5,000-nit display (vs 3,000 nits on the original) that looks flawless even in harsh mid-morning summer sun.
The Ultra 2 edges closer to sports watch territory with a dedicated trail-running mode that surfaces real-time climb and elevation data, has offline trail map access and hydration reminders. I live near a regional park with hundreds of trail options, and I’ve been frustrated by traditional smartwatches that don’t account for uneven terrain or give me enough credit for the extreme elevation changes.

After a 5-mile trail run through the Northern California hills, I was impressed by two things: turn-by-turn audio navigation and real-time elevation tracking. I don’t like wearing headphones when I trail run because I prefer to stay aware of my surroundings, so hearing directions through the watch speaker is the perfect solution. It’s worth noting that getting a route onto the watch for those directions was tedious. Samsung says you’ll eventually be able to search for nearby trails directly from Google Maps, but that feature wasn’t ready during my testing, so I had to load a trail route from a .gpx file on my phone.
With real-time elevation tracking, the watch automatically broke my route into individual climbs and showed my progress. Having a live progress bar as I approach a hill gives me a tangible goal, making it easier to push through steeper sections.

I was less enthused about the hydration reminders. I’d traded my water bottle for my tripod that day, so the three reminders I received during my hour-long trail run mostly fell on deaf ears. Considering the heat, I probably should have listened. But because the reminders are based on AI estimates of hydration loss rather than a dedicated sensor that measures sweat loss directly, I found myself trusting them less.
The Ultra 2 also debuts a recreational diving feature developed in partnership with Italian diving company Mares. Because it doesn’t track gas or oxygen consumption, it’s not meant to replace a dedicated dive computer. Instead, it seems aimed at casual recreational divers who want basic dive information on a device they’re already wearing. The app won’t be available at launch, so I’ll reserve judgment until I can test it myself later this year.

Galaxy Watch Ultra 2’s raise-to-talk Gemini
My favorite feature, however, has nothing to do with rugged adventure sports. It’s Gemini. I’ve already raved about how useful Google’s AI assistant is on your wrist in smartwatches like the Google Pixel 4, and the new raise-to-talk feature makes it even better.
No button presses or wake words required, just raise your wrist and start talking. This added layer of convenience made me much more likely to use it and helped me get things done completely hands-free. At the risk of sounding like a trad wife, I use it a lot in the kitchen. I had meat sitting in the fridge that was about to go bad, so I asked for a simple slow cooker carnitas recipe, and it delivered. I didn’t even have to smudge the screen with meat juice to get the step-by-step instructions read aloud. It’s also been handy for settling debates with my endlessly curious 9-year-old before he loses patience and I have to dig my phone out of my pocket.
The Ultra 2 packs an 800-mAh battery, up from 590-mAh on the original, paired with Qualcomm’s new Snapdragon Wear Elite processor, which should be more power efficient. On-device AI that optimizes battery life as it learns your habits. Samsung rates it for up to 60 hours with the watch’s always-on display enabled.

It’s still too soon to know if that 60-hour claim is realistic because my initial results haven’t been great. That five-mile trail run chewed through nearly 30% of the battery, and I have yet to reach the watch’s promised 60-hour mark. I have gotten closer to 48 hours before needing to recharge, though.
Either way, don’t expect sports watch-level endurance. A Garmin Fenix 8 Pro, for example, can last more than a week on a charge. The Ultra 2 powers a brighter display, Wear OS and always-ready Gemini, all of which demand far more energy than what a dedicated sports watch.
Both watches also get a new suite of health features, which feed into the redesigned Samsung Health app on your phone.
Vitals tracking can flag possible signs of illness by monitoring metrics like heart rate variability, resting heart rate, respiratory rate, blood oxygen and skin temperature. There’s also a new Heart Health Score, Daily Cardio Load to help guide recovery, and a Fitness Index assessment that uses AI to build you a personalized training plan.
Many of these features require at least seven nights of sleep before they unlock (which I haven’t yet logged), so I’m holding off on judging for now.
I appreciate that Samsung isn’t putting these health insights behind a subscription the way companies like Whoop and Oura do. Some guided workouts and iFit content still require separate subscriptions, but the core health features are included with the watch.
Samsung also hasn’t confirmed whether these software features will come to older Galaxy Watches. So, for now, they’re another point in favor of upgrading.

After a week of testing, the Ultra 2 feels like more of an upgrade than its familiar design would suggest. If you’re coming from an older Galaxy Watch and want the latest hardware with the peace of mind that it’ll hold up to the elements, this is the one I’d be looking at.
But I still have plenty left to test. Many of the health features haven’t unlocked yet, and I need to spend more time with the battery before delivering a final verdict. Battery life, in particular, will make or break my recommendation — both over the Galaxy Watch 9 and for anyone considering upgrading from the original Ultra.

GitHub and PyPI (Python Package Index) have introduced a time-based mechanism in the Dependabot dependency management tool to protect against supply-chain attacks and to limit their impact.
Specifically, Dependabot comes with a default three-day cooldown setting, while PyPI will reject new files uploaded to releases older than 14 days.
The measure comes after the two development ecosystems experienced multiple high-profile attacks over the past year. Some notable examples include the ‘chalk’ and ‘debug’ attacks, the “s1ngularity” operation, the Shai-Hulud campaign, and the GhostAction supply-chain attack.
GitHub announced last month changes to tackle supply chain threats, and the hardening process progresses with the new measures.
Dependabot is GitHub’s dependency-update service that reads files containing information about new package versions and opens update pull requests to notify software maintainers.
The tool now delays the package update process for 72 hours to reduce the risk of automatically adopting newly published malicious packages.
In many recent cases, malicious npm packages were detected and flagged by security tools within minutes of being published.
However, quick detection alone does not remove the threat, as repository maintainers and vendors must still take action to remove the packages, leaving a window during which developers and projects may download and incorporate the malicious code.
While GitHub explained that the period of three days was chosen as a balanced point between avoiding risky releases while keeping up with the latest upgrades, it noted that users still have the option to configure a shorter or longer delay through Dependabot’s ‘cooldown’ configuration option.
GitHub highlighted Dependabot’s cooldown limitations against longer-term compromise, recommending the use of lockfiles for dependency pinning, restricted-scope tokens, and disabling unnecessary installation scripts in CI.
PyPI announced that it now blocks maintainers from adding new files to a package release after 14 days have passed since its publication.
The measure is intended to prevent attackers who compromise publishing tokens or workflows from poisoning old, trusted releases.
The platform found that only a very small percentage of projects legitimately uploaded more than two weeks after publishing a release.
It should be noted that no known past attacks on PyPI have been confirmed to use the said release poisoning technique that this new measure blocks, but the platform is acting preventatively in this case to block a dangerous possibility.

Accenture’s Emma Woodhouse, a manufacturing and supply chain systems manager for manufacturing execution systems (MES), specialises in designing and implementing electronic batch records that help improve efficiency, quality and compliance for global pharmaceutical clients, bringing their production processes into the digital age.
“No two days are the same in my role as a manufacturing execution systems designer, which is one of the things I enjoy most about the job,” she told SiliconRepublic.com.
“One thing I’ve learned is that no matter how carefully you plan your day, there is always potential for a new challenge to appear when you least expect it. That’s part of what keeps the role interesting.
“Managing workload requires balancing multiple tasks and deadlines across different projects. Technical documentation, testing activities and troubleshooting are also important parts of the role, helping to ensure that solutions are delivered to a high standard and also perform as expected.”
The nature of MES projects can vary based on the specific requirements of the client. Some projects may be on a large global scale where a client is looking to roll out MES implementation across multiple or all of their manufacturing sites around the world. This presents an opportunity to pursue a standardised approach in terms of the design of the electronic batch records.
These projects challenge me to think creatively about how processes can be simplified, standardised and made more efficient while still meeting the needs of different manufacturing sites. I enjoy working through complex requirements and finding solutions that can be reused and scaled across a wider program.
Alternatively, a project may be on a smaller scale working with one manufacturing site to implement or improve master batch records, often due to a new product introduction, new equipment introduction or some other driving force for process improvement. These types of projects often allow project teams to form a tight-knit group which aids collaboration.
Some of the most rewarding projects have been those where I have been involved from the initial design stages right through to testing and deployment. Seeing a solution go from a concept on paper to a system that is actively supporting manufacturing operations is incredibly satisfying.
My role draws on a combination of technical, analytical and interpersonal skills every day.
Problem-solving and attention to detail are particularly important, as I am often translating complex manufacturing processes into electronic workflows while ensuring compliance with strict quality and regulatory requirements. I also use project management and organisational skills to balance multiple priorities, meet deadlines and co-ordinate activities across different workstreams.
While the technical aspects of MES are important, a significant part of the job involves working with people from different backgrounds and areas of expertise. I regularly collaborate with manufacturing operators, engineers, quality specialists, validation teams and project managers, all of whom may have different perspectives and priorities. Being able to listen, ask the right questions, and clearly explain technical concepts has become just as important as the technical knowledge itself.
Manufacturing environments are constantly evolving and projects can change direction as new requirements emerge. Being able to learn quickly, think creatively and adjust to new challenges has been invaluable.
One of the most challenging aspects of my role is balancing the need for focused, uninterrupted work with the demands of collaboration.
Designing and configuring MES solutions often requires significant concentration, yet projects also involve regular meetings and stakeholder interactions across multiple functions, all of which are essential to delivering the right solution.
To navigate this, I prioritise my workload carefully and try to structure my day around key objectives. I set aside dedicated time for tasks that require focus, while also ensuring I remain available for collaboration and support when needed. Having a clear understanding of priorities helps me stay productive and prevents smaller tasks from distracting me from the most important deliverables.
Maintaining a healthy work-life balance is also important.
Working in a fast-paced industry means there can always be another task to tackle, but I’ve learned the value of stepping away from work and recharging. For me, spending time on my own hobbies such as DIY, coding and music production is a great way to switch off after a busy day.
My three dogs are also very effective at enforcing work-life balance. They have little interest in project deadlines, but they’re extremely committed to their walk and fetch schedules.
Taking that time to disconnect helps me return to work with a fresh perspective and ultimately helps me be more effective in my role.
When I explain my job to friends and family, many are surprised by how digital modern pharmaceutical manufacturing has become. The reality is that technology now plays a central role in ensuring medicines are produced safely, efficiently and consistently.
Historically, many manufacturing processes relied heavily on paper-based documentation and manual data entry. Today, there is a much greater focus on digital systems, automation, data integrity and real-time access to information, which has expanded both the scope and impact of the role.
As technology has advanced, MES designers have become more involved in designing connected, data-driven solutions that support efficiency, quality, and compliance across the manufacturing life cycle. There is also a growing emphasis on standardisation, scalability and leveraging data to drive continuous improvement. This means the role now requires not only technical expertise but also a strong understanding of business processes, regulatory expectations and how different digital systems interact within a manufacturing environment.

Phone screens are better than they’ve ever been—bigger, sharper, and brighter—but they don’t always offer the best displays for extended reading sessions. If you’ve got a lot of text to get through, you might find yourself turning to a Kindle instead, or even a good old-fashioned physical book.
There are ways to tweak the screen configuration on your iPhone or Android phone, however, to make it more suitable for reading. These changes will reduce the chance of causing you eye strain while minimizing clutter to create a more pleasant reading experience. You won’t transform your phone into something that rivals an e-reader or the printed page, but you can certainly get closer to it.
You’ve actually got more control over the font sizes, styles, and colors used by your phone than you might have realized—you can make text easier to read and create a more Kindle-like experience with just a few taps via the main Settings panel.
If you’re on Android, the menu labels will vary from model to model, but on Pixel phones head to Display size and text. The next screen lets you adjust the size of the default font and other on-screen elements to make text bolder, and there’s also a Dark theme option that you might find reduces eye strain.
Adjusting the font size on Android.Courtesy of David Nield
Over on iOS, open up Display & Brightness from Settings: Here you’ll find a Text Size slider you can adjust, as well as a Bold Text toggle switch. As on Android, there’s a dark mode option here via the theme selector at the top of the screen—select Dark to dim the colors all across the iOS interface.
Both Android and iOS also have a night reading mode that reduces the blue light emitted from your phone and makes the whole display warmer—which should make for a more pleasant reading experience. On Android Pixel phones, choose Display and touch > Night Light from Settings, and on iOS pick Display & Brightness > Night Shift. In both cases you can enable the feature manually or via a schedule.
Much of the reading you’re going to be doing on your phone will be through its web browser, and most modern mobile browsers come with a dedicated reading mode you can use. These modes will reduce onscreen clutter, simplify the color scheme, and bring the main article text to the fore.
If you’re using Google Chrome as your default browser on Android, tap the three dots (top right), then Show Reading mode to switch views for the article you’re currently reading. Swipe up on the panel at the bottom of the screen to change the font and color options. Tap the reading mode icon (just to the right of the address bar) to return to the normal browser view.
The exciting part of buying a ‘broken, for parts’ off a site like EBay is that you rarely know exactly just how ‘broken’ it truly is. Even if the seller insists that it’s thoroughly buggered, you just might be able to eke out a fix with some out-of-the-box thinking and plucky ingenuity. Such was the case for [Dieter Vansteenwegen] who gambled on a cheap Canon 7D Mark II DSLR body that was sold for a mere €180 on account of broken condition.
After confirming that the DSLR’s condition was basically as described by the seller, with nothing on the LCD or HDMI output and the auto-focus not working while partially pressing the trigger button, but still taking a picture when fully pressed. Sometimes it would also show a standard maintenance message on the LCD, so clearly it ought to be working. Maybe the camera’s processor was just being chronically unhappy about something, in which case an easy fix might be possible.
As anyone who has ever taken a digital camera apart knows, you do not simply pop them open for a quick look. Somewhere in the nightmarish contraption of flatflex cables, PCBs and endless sub-assemblies there might be a fault, but where to start? Fortunately with some support from the custom Canon firmware community Magic Lantern and the website Photo Parts UA for reference images he was able to start tracing a number of pertinent signals.
With the auto-focus hint as guide, this was traced back to the MPU, which turned out to have a floating signal on the auto-focus pin that got interpreted as ‘active’. Likely the internal pull-up got damaged due to the use of an external trigger module as there’s no real protection on these lines. One bodge wire later to create an external 3.3 V pull-up the DSLR happily sprung back to life.
In terms of parts this definitely was a cheap repair, but it comes with the prerequisite of having the skills and equipment to perform said repair. Still, massive props and congratulations to [Dieter] for saving this DSLR from being merely a device to be picked over for parts.

Click To Pray, a prayer app endorsed by the Pope with hundreds of thousands of users worldwide, has leaked people’s names and email addresses for months – or longer – according to an ethical hacker who said she found and reported the security vulnerability six months ago to no avail. This app needs to take a vow of silence when it comes to your personal information.
The app, available in seven languages and on iOS, Android, and clicktopray.org, is the official app of the Pope’s Worldwide Prayer Network. It connects users across the globe to pray for the Holy Father’s intentions, and as of July 2026, it has 719,517 registered accounts.
It’s also very leaky, according to security sleuth BobDaHacker, who says she spotted and disclosed the vulnerability to the Pope’s Worldwide Prayer Network on January 3.
“The vulnerability is still live,” the hacker said in a Friday blog. “Nobody has ever responded. I guess my email wasn’t in their prayers.”
The Reg readers likely remember BobDaHacker for her previous research exposing a free-food flaw in McDonald’s ordering system and open controls on Chinese robot manufacturer Pudu Robotics.
This latest security hole stems from an Insecure Direct Object Reference (IDOR) bug in the prayer app. This is a very common and easy-to-exploit type of flaw that occurs when a website or an app blindly accepts user-provided input to view or modify resources without checking to see if the user is actually authorized to retrieve the data.
“You ask for your own data, the server gives it to you,” BobDaHacker explains. “You ask for someone else’s data, the server gives you that too. Thou shalt not authorize, apparently.”
When you sign up for a Click To Pray account, the app assigns you a sequential numeric user ID. As BobDaHacker uncovered, the API endpoint GET https://api[.]clicktopray.org/user/users/{id} will return user data for any account – not just your own account – so long as you supply a valid, five-digit user ID.
It doesn’t perform any authorization check or ownership validation. “Just increment the number and get someone else’s data,” she wrote.
This data includes users’ email addresses, first and last names, country, dates of birth, and whether the account has been deleted, and the API exposes all 719,517 accounts on the prayer site. “With sequential user IDs and no rate limiting, an attacker could enumerate every single account on the platform,” the hacker explained. “One GET request per user. for i in range(1, 719518): scrape(). That’s it. That’s the exploit.”
As BobDaHacker points out, many of these users are likely older individuals, not all that tech savvy, and very trusting of anything Vatican related, making these exposed accounts a “phishing goldmine.”
“Imagine getting an email that says ‘The Holy Father requests your urgent attention’ with a Vatican-looking link,” she wrote. “Grandma is clicking that. Every time.”
And then it gets even worse.
The signup endpoint, POST https://api.clicktopray.org/user/users/sign-up, returns the account’s validation_hash directly in the response body, and that value is the same UUID used in the email verification link. This means someone could sign up using any email address and verify the account before the confirmation message reached the inbox.
Plus, BobDaHacker’s email client flagged the real verification email with a warning that it had failed the domain’s authentication requirements and might have been spoofed or improperly forwarded.
“So not only is the API leaking 700,000 email addresses that could be used for phishing, but the real emails from Click To Pray already look like phishing,” the hacker noted. “An attacker wouldn’t even need to try hard. They could send a pixel-perfect phishing email and it would have the same level of email authentication as the real thing: none. God works in mysterious ways.”
The Register reached out to the Pope’s Worldwide Prayer Network and did not receive any response. BobDaHacker says she’s still praying for one, too.®
Your battery is continually losing charge.
Even though smartphone batteries are getting bigger and more efficient, there’s always that inevitable event when you get a low battery notification at the worst possible time. You might think powering down the phone entirely is a way to make your smartphone last longer. But like with any battery-powered device, a phone’s battery will slowly deplete when you’re not actively using it, and even when it’s completely powered down.
Of course, the battery drains much more slowly when turned off, so it’s not a bad idea to power down the phone to conserve battery. That might be before a plane takes off, for example, and you want to ensure you have power when you arrive at your destination. If you leave an old phone in a drawer for weeks or months then decide to use it, however, you’ll find that the battery isn’t still at the same percentage it was when you left it.
Why does this happen? One thing that draws battery from your phone while it’s off is a clock-and-wake circuit, which uses a tiny amount of current so that the power button responds when you want to turn it on and so the phone immediately knows the right time and date once it boots back up. But the biggest battery drain is something called a self-discharge, a chemical release of the lithium-ion batteries used in phones. The battery will lose about 1-2 percent of its power every month or so when turned off. If you store it in a spot that’s above room temperature, it will deplete even faster than that.
If you leave the phone on and don’t use it, the battery will logically drain much more quickly. I have left Android phones I’m testing untouched for up to a week, for example, and they easily go from about half charge to completely dead in that time. That said, if you’re giving a phone a break, it’s still a good idea to power it down completely. While there’s still that self-discharge, it will be much slower than if you leave the phone on. When the device is on, the screen lights up for notifications, the radio remains active and latched onto signals, and background apps are using power.
If you plan to keep a phone tucked away long-term, like if you upgraded and you’re waiting for your pre-teen to become of age so they can use it, it’s wise to keep the device charged consistently to avoid damage. Apple recommends not fully charging your phone before you put it away for an extended period, suggesting you charge an iPhone only to about 50 percent. Then recharge it every so often (Apple recommends every six months) so it’s always topped up and not lying completely dormant.
This prevents something called a deep-discharge state, which can happen when a device’s battery has been completely dead for a long period of time. If it gets to this point, the phone’s battery’s copper current collector can dissolve, redeposit, and permanently impact the phone’s battery capacity, or even potentially cause a short circuit. At the very least, the loss in battery capacity means the phone wont last as long per charge going forward.
To recap, if you’re storing a phone, power it down when the battery is at about 50 percent and charge it back up to this point at least every six months. Most importantly, don’t throw it in a drawer completely dead nor fully charged. Don’t forget to store it in a cool, dry place with temperatures below 90°F.
All that said, leaving a phone lying around for months isn’t a total death sentence. I have left some of the best Android phones released over the last five years powered down for months and charged them for comparative reviews. They work fine even if the battery capacity isn’t as good. I even recently found an old BlackBerry PlayBook tablet that hadn’t been booted up since 2011. I plugged it in and it successfully charged and works! But it’s clear the battery life has lessened as it barely lasts a day before I need to recharge it.
The bottom line is that if you power down your phone, it won’t have the same charge state when you power it back up, especially if weeks or months have gone by. It might still show the same battery percentage if you’ve only powered it down for a 12-hour flight, but the battery is still draining through self-discharge and the clock-and-wake circuit, albeit so slowly you won’t notice after such a short period of time. However long you turn off the phone, powering down doesn’t mean the phone’s battery is completely on pause until you use it again. But it can help conserve what battery life you have left in a pinch.
